FAQ
What are common signs that my LG refrigerator compressor needs replacement in Kenosha?
Common signs include excessive heat from the back, loud humming or clicking sounds, and the fridge failing to maintain cool temperatures. If your LG refrigerator isn't cooling in Kenosha, a faulty compressor might be the culprit.
How much does it typically cost to replace a compressor on an LG refrigerator in Kenosha?
Compressor replacement costs in Kenosha vary based on the model and service provider. It's a significant repair, often exceeding $300, but we recommend getting quotes from local technicians to get an accurate estimate for your appliance.
Is it better to repair or replace a refrigerator with a bad compressor in Kenosha?
If your refrigenerator is older than 10 years or the repair cost exceeds half the price of a new unit, replacing it might be more economical. However, for newer LG models in Kenosha, repairing the compressor can extend its life.
Can a faulty compressor cause other problems like ice maker issues in LG refrigerators?
Yes, a failing compressor can lead to inadequate cooling, which may result in ice maker issues such as slow ice production or melting. If you're experiencing these problems in Kenosha, having the compressor checked is a good first step.
